Course Content

• Climate Change Impacts and Vulnerability Assessment
• Data Acquisition and Preprocessing for Climate Applications
• Statistical Modelling and Time Series Analysis for Climate Data
• Geographic Information Systems (GIS) and Spatial Analysis for Climate Adaptation
• Machine Learning for Climate Change Prediction and Forecasting
• Climate Change Adaptation Strategies and Policy
• Communicating Climate Data and Findings Effectively
• Climate Change Risk Management and Decision Support Systems
• Remote Sensing and Satellite Data for Climate Monitoring (includes secondary keywords: remote sensing, satellite imagery)
• Case Studies in Climate Change Data Analytics and Adaptation

Career path

Career Role Description
Climate Data Analyst (Certified Specialist) Analyze climate data to inform adaptation strategies. Develop predictive models using advanced statistical methods. High demand in UK environmental agencies.
Climate Change Adaptation Consultant (Certified Specialist) Advise businesses and governments on climate risks and resilience. Develop adaptation plans and strategies based on data analysis and risk assessment. Strong understanding of climate science and policy required.
Sustainability Data Scientist (Certified Specialist) Develop and apply machine learning algorithms to environmental data. Create innovative solutions for climate change mitigation and adaptation. Strong programming and data visualization skills are crucial.
Environmental Data Engineer (Certified Specialist) Design and implement data pipelines for processing climate and environmental data. Build and maintain large-scale data infrastructure. Expertise in cloud computing and big data technologies preferred.
